Abstract
In this paper, we summarize some known results concerning the so-called Fučík spectrum arising in problems with jumping nonlinearities and the Pareto spectrum (or the K-spectrum) connected with linear complementarity problems. We show a surprising relation between these two notions and illustrate it on several examples.
